Singapore - Import of Polyethylene Waste or Scrap
Since 2014, Singapore Import of Polyethylene Waste or Scrap grew 7.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 66 comparing other countries in Import of Polyethylene Waste or Scrap at $442,440.34. Singapore is overtaken by Paraguay, which was number 65 with $548,074 and is followed by Palestine with $423,582.11. China topped the ranking with $265,029,474.81 in 2019, +3,353.9% compared to 2018. Malaysia, Netherlands and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Senegal recorded the best 5 years average growth at +624.9% per year, while Angola recorded the worst performance at -89.6% per year.

Date | US Dollars |
---|---|
2019 | 442,440.34 |
2018 | 496,945.06 |
2017 | 421,646.63 |
2016 | 47,487.23 |
2015 | 58,061.72 |
